Lines Matching refs:g_chartab
28 static char_u g_chartab[256]; variable
96 g_chartab[c++] = (dy_flags & DY_UHEX) ? 4 : 2; in buf_init_chartab()
102 g_chartab[c++] = 1 + CT_PRINT_CHAR; in buf_init_chartab()
107 g_chartab[c++] = CT_PRINT_CHAR + 1; in buf_init_chartab()
110 g_chartab[c++] = CT_PRINT_CHAR + 1; in buf_init_chartab()
113 g_chartab[c++] = CT_PRINT_CHAR + 2; in buf_init_chartab()
116 g_chartab[c++] = (dy_flags & DY_UHEX) ? 4 : 2; in buf_init_chartab()
124 g_chartab[c] |= CT_FNAME_CHAR; in buf_init_chartab()
218 g_chartab[c] &= ~CT_ID_CHAR; in buf_init_chartab()
220 g_chartab[c] |= CT_ID_CHAR; in buf_init_chartab()
234 g_chartab[c] = (g_chartab[c] & ~CT_CELL_MASK) in buf_init_chartab()
236 g_chartab[c] &= ~CT_PRINT_CHAR; in buf_init_chartab()
240 g_chartab[c] = (g_chartab[c] & ~CT_CELL_MASK) + 1; in buf_init_chartab()
241 g_chartab[c] |= CT_PRINT_CHAR; in buf_init_chartab()
248 g_chartab[c] &= ~CT_FNAME_CHAR; in buf_init_chartab()
250 g_chartab[c] |= CT_FNAME_CHAR; in buf_init_chartab()
667 return (g_chartab[b] & CT_CELL_MASK); in byte2cells()
694 return (g_chartab[c & 0xff] & CT_CELL_MASK); in char2cells()
708 return (g_chartab[*p] & CT_CELL_MASK); in ptr2cells()
832 return (c > 0 && c < 0x100 && (g_chartab[c] & CT_ID_CHAR)); in vim_isIDc()
896 return (c >= 0x100 || (c > 0 && (g_chartab[c] & CT_FNAME_CHAR))); in vim_isfilec()
925 return (c >= 0x100 || (c > 0 && (g_chartab[c] & CT_PRINT_CHAR))); in vim_isprintc()
939 return (c >= 0x100 || (c > 0 && (g_chartab[c] & CT_PRINT_CHAR))); in vim_isprintc_strict()
1291 incr = g_chartab[c] & CT_CELL_MASK; in getvcol()
1304 incr = g_chartab[c] & CT_CELL_MASK; in getvcol()